As for using the wireless kit with other jammers it would work like this, the front 2 heads will wire to the kit which stays under the hood and plugs into the LI interface.
As for the rear heads you do not need 2 kits, but here is the tricky part. You will need to wire them from the rear to the front, either under the car and away from moving parts and heat back to the LI interface under the hood or run it into the interior of the car say through the trunk, then passenger compartment through the firewall and into the LI interface.
Then the wireless kit will transmit the signals to the receiver in the cabin or through the Cheetah Mirror.
